Welcome to KOMPRESSOR - Superchargers
and Compressors Kompressor Performance - How does
the Mercedes Compressor work ? The Mercedes Compressor (Kompressor as they are termed in German) is available in 4 cylinder, 6 cylinder, 8 cylinder and 12 cylinder varieties with the AMG Sport Series being the most powerful of all the Kompressor offerings. With the entry level C Series Elegance and Avant Guarde C180 and C200 Series. The smaller sized 4 Cylinder Kompressor engine functions very well without compromising acceleration for fuel economy. The more upbeat 6 Cylinder Kompressor C230 SLK Sports Sedan and CLK Sports Coupe (or Koupe in German) version is slightly more sporty with power, torque, throttle response and acceleration to impress even the most developed performance minded enthusiasts. AMG Kompressor - Mercedes Supercharged Sports Cars Stepping up to the King of the Kompressors, the AMG Series, the performance is really felt with a V8 Kompressor Supercharger boasting over 500 Kilowatts of Power and 800 Newton Metres of Torque. This animal is nothing short of a supercharged beast, wielding and ability to scatter from 0-100km/h in a blistering, mind boggling 4.2 seconds and cover the 1/4 mile in less than 12 seconds ! If you want to go all out, you can order the V12 AMG Series Kompressor supercharger with over 700 KW and 1200 Nm of Torque.
